ABSTRACT:
A sub-Nyguist sampling encoder and decoder has a plurality of interpolators provided in an encoder and corresponding plural interpolators provided in a decoder. Information indicating which interpolator can be used to minimize the interpolation error is superimposed on a value of a non-thinned-out pixel and transmitted from the encoder to the decoder, and the decoder receiving the information is permitted to always perform optimum interpolation. The interpolation information is superimposed on the least significant bit of the value of the non-thinned-out pixel, with the view of effecting the superimposition without increasing the amount of transmission data and without degrading quality of the video signal.
